Episode description

This week Llewelyn looked at Jesus’ response to the prohibition against murder in the ten commandments.


Jesus calls his listeners to honestly pay attention to who and what they truly love. For Jesus, real righteousness and wisdom means treating every human like they have ultimate value, dignity and worth. God’s Kingdom is meant to reshape our hearts, our character and our imagination.


Llewelyn left us with the following questions to ponder:

  1. What is the Spirit saying to you about your own heart and actions? (Spirit Drawn & Led)
  2. What do your actions show about your heart and who you are? (Growing Down)
  3. How do we live in such a way as to value restoration and right relationship? (Character Formation)
  4. How can you look upon others and see the image of God? (Moral Imagination)
  5. How can you forgo judgement on others and allow God to be the judge? (Fear of the Lord)
